Key differences

  • HDV costs 0.57% less per year.
  • HDV is significantly larger than DIVZ — larger funds tend to be more liquid and less likely to close.
  • DIVZ follows a active selection strategy; HDV uses index tracking.
  • HDV has a longer track record, which may reduce uncertainty around long-term behavior.
